Feedback on this practice reflects a deeply mixed experience, with stark contrasts between clinical and administrative performance. When patients access care, medical staff consistently receive praise for clinical expertise, compassion, and responsiveness to urgent needs. However, significant frustration centres on appointment access and booking systems, with patients reporting lengthy phone queues, ineffective online platforms, and communication failures that create substantial barriers to care. Reception experience varies considerably, with some describing helpful and professional interactions while others report dismissive attitudes and lack of courtesy.
Appointment availability emerges as the most persistent concern across reviews, with patients describing impossible scheduling processes, extended waiting times, and redirects to alternative services. The practice's administrative systems—including triage procedures, callback arrangements, and booking mechanisms—generate repeated complaints about inefficiency and poor organisation. Several patients note that despite appreciating the quality of clinical care once accessed, the administrative obstacles are so significant they have switched providers or actively avoid using the service.
Positive feedback highlights staff warmth, professional medical care, and efficient test processing when systems function smoothly. Longer-term patients often report satisfaction with continuity and clinical outcomes. The contrast between clinical quality and administrative dysfunction suggests systemic issues in practice management rather than individual staff capability, with particular concern around appointment access creating barriers that may delay necessary medical care.

My Experience with Wells Park Practice – Safeguarding, Disability Support and Communication Concerns I am Simone Dhana, and I am writing this review as the mother of my son, Ralph-Angel. My experience with Wells Park Practice has left me extremely concerned about the handling of serious safeguarding matters concerning my son, the lack of communication with our family and the lack of disability-related communication support. In January 2026, following serious safeguarding concerns and an allegation of abuse involving my son at school, the hospital referred the matter to my son's GP. The Safeguarding Lead Doctor at Wells Park Practice subsequently requested our parental consent to communicate with the Local Authority regarding my son's safeguarding. We provided that consent because we believed the Practice would follow the matter up and keep us appropriately informed. However, from January 2026 to July 2026, what we experienced was largely silence. We did not receive the meaningful safeguarding updates or evidence of follow-up that we expected. This has left me asking a very basic question as Ralph-Angel's mother: what did Wells Park Practice actually do after receiving these serious safeguarding concerns about my son? No Effective Disability Communication Support I am also extremely disappointed by the lack of effective disability-related communication support I have experienced from Wells Park Practice. I have explained that I have difficulties which affect how I access and manage complicated information and online systems. I have asked for reasonable adjustments and accessible communication. Instead of feeling supported, I have experienced barriers and silence. On 10 July 2026, after acknowledging our written complaint dated 8 July 2026, the Practice informed me that emails from addresses that were not NHS.net would not be replied to and directed me to use its online contact forms. For somebody who has specifically explained that they experience difficulties accessing these systems and requires reasonable adjustments, I found this response extremely concerning. A reasonable adjustment should make communication more accessible, not direct a patient back to the very method they have explained causes them difficulty. Our Subject Access Request On 8 July 2026, we also submitted a Subject Access Request (SAR) seeking my son's records and evidence relating to his healthcare and safeguarding. We want to establish exactly what Wells Park Practice and its Safeguarding Lead did, including communications with the Local Authority, safeguarding referrals or follow-ups, responses received and actions recorded concerning our son. As of 10 August 2026, we have not received the requested records. If appropriate safeguarding action was taken, we are simply asking the Practice to provide the records so that we can see what happened and when. Because of the seriousness of the safeguarding concerns, the communication difficulties, the lack of effective disability-related communication support and our difficulties obtaining our son's records, we have now instructed solicitors to assist us. As Ralph-Angel's mother, I should not have to struggle to communicate with my GP practice or obtain information concerning serious safeguarding matters involving my son. I want Wells Park Practice to provide transparency, release the records we have requested, properly address my reasonable-adjustment needs and explain what safeguarding actions were taken concerning Ralph-Angel. After months of trying to obtain answers, silence is not an acceptable form of communication or disability support. This review represents my personal experience and the concerns that remain unresolved at the time of writing. Simone Dhana Mother of Ralph-Angel

Terrible gp service with dangerous medical errors
I've had the most appalling experience with this GP practice. Initially, when I joined 3-4 years ago, the service was excellent and the nurses were outstanding. However, the past 18 months have been abysmal. I nearly died last year after developing sepsis and requiring emergency surgery due to a series of critical errors, primarily stemming from poor communication, administrative staff failing to follow through on commitments, and a rigid, unhelpful bureaucratic approach that disregards proper medical procedures. During my post-operative period, I needed frequent dressing changes and repeatedly found myself stranded in the waiting area while staff addressed administrative mistakes like incomplete forms and unsigned prescriptions. On one particularly distressing occasion, I sought pain relief for a painful vac pump dressing change, but the prescription wasn't correctly processed. The receptionist left me waiting over an hour, forcing me to leave for another appointment and endure an excruciatingly painful dressing change without medication. I reported these incidents and met with the manager, who promised a thorough investigation and apologies, yet nothing has changed. I now actively avoid this practice due to the consistent chaos. The trauma of these experiences weighs heavily on me. Currently, I'm sitting in the waiting room after being assured my regular blood test forms would be available, only to be told they aren't, and that I must submit another request and consult a GP before scheduling my routine blood test. The incompetence is absolutely infuriating!
